#68eab5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#68eab5 is composed of 40.8% red, 91.8% green and 71%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 22.6% yellow and 8.2% black. It has a hue angle of 155.5 degrees, a saturation of 75.6% and a lightness of 66.3%. #68eab5 color hex could be obtained by blending #d0ffff with #00d56b. Closest websafe color is: #66ffcc.

Shades and Tints of #68eab5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010403 is the darkest color, while #f2fdf9 is the lightest one.
